Background :Arginine and glutamate-rich protein 1: Dual function regulator of gene expression; regulator of transcription and modulator of alternative splicing . General coactivator of nuclear receptor-induced gene expression, including genes activated by the glucocorticoid receptor NR3C1 . Binds to a subset of pre-mRNAs and to components of the spliceosome machinery to directly modulate basal alternative splicing; involved in simple and complex cassette exon splicing events . Binds its own pre-mRNA and regulates its alternative splicing and degradation; one of the alternatively spliced products is a stable intronic sequence RNA (sisRNA) that binds the protein to regulate its ability to affect splicing . Binding of the sisRNA stimulates phase separation and localization to nuclear speckles, which may contribute to activation of nuclear receptor-induced gene expression .
